What to Include in a Erie Service Agreement
A valid Service Agreement in Erie, Pennsylvania should contain the following essential elements:
- Full legal name and address of both parties in Erie
- Service Agreement date and unique reference / ID number
- Detailed description of services, goods, or terms
- Payment amounts, due dates, and accepted methods
- Pennsylvania state-required disclosures and clauses
- Signatures of all relevant parties
- Governing law clause referencing Pennsylvania
